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What is the primary difference between the PB481 and PB482 cables?
The PB481 cable features a USB Type C to MiniUSB 2.0 connector, which is typically used for older cameras, MP3 players, and specific legacy devices. The PB482 cable features a USB Type C to USB Type B 2.0 connector, which is commonly used to connect computers directly to printers, scanners, and MIDI devices.
Q: Can I use these cables to charge my devices?
Yes, both cables support power delivery. The charging speeds will be limited by the standard USB 2.0 specification configurations and the maximum power capacity supported by the connected receiving device.
Q: Do these USB 2.0 cables require drivers to function?
No, these cables are fully plug-and-play. They do not require any driver installation or configuration; simply connect them directly to your compatible USB Type-C host and target devices.
Q: What is the data transfer speed of these cables?
Both the PB481 and PB482 cables operate on the USB 2.0 standard protocol, supporting high-speed data transmission rates up to 480 Mbps.
Q: Are these cables compatible with Thunderbolt 3 or Thunderbolt 4 ports?
Yes, they are compatible. You can connect the USB Type-C end of these cables to Thunderbolt 3 or Thunderbolt 4 ports on your laptop or desktop, and they will operate reliably at USB 2.0 transfer speeds.
